Trianon

NEWSFLASH | 12 MAY 2026

E.C IFPM up and slight vacancy decrease

Trianon delivered a solid Q1 report, with rental income and NOI 2/1% above our expectations, but with negative net letting

of SEK -0,3m. LFL rental income increased by 3.7% y/y. Economic occupancy rate for the portfolio came in at 96.6% (+10bps

q/q). IFPM came in +8% vs. PASe (+14% y/y), while E.C IFPMPS grew by 4% q/q. We expect to make some minor positive

estimate revisions on the back of the report and shares to trade slightly above the real estate peers today. We have Buy

recommendation and a 12-month target price of SEK 26.

Key takeaways

• Rental income and NOI came in 2/1% above PASe, where the cold winter resulted in higher property costs of SEK 5m, weighing on NOI

• Negative net letting of SEK -0,3m

• LFL rental income growth of 3.7% y/y

• Economic occupancy for the portfolio increased slightly by 10bps q/q to 96.6%

• IFPM came in 8% above our expectations, mainly explained by explained by lower CA due to fewer employees than in 2025, while E.C

IFPM per share grew by 4% q/q

Conclusions for the share

• We have a Buy rating and a 12-month target price of SEK 26

• We expect to make minor positive estimate revisions to our rental income and NOI estimates on the back of the report, but expect higher

market interest curves to weigh on our IFPM and CEPS estimates

• We expect shares to trade slightly above the real estate peers today
